Despite 90-100 degree Texas heat my chlorine levels are rising each week. It was at 7 last week and now it's at almost 9, and I've turned down the setting on my inline trichlor thing. I know trichlor isn't the way to go, and I plan to put in an SWG system next year, but for now I'm dealing with trichlor
Here are the stats...
FC - 8.5-9
pH - 7.6
TA - 90
CH - 250
CYA - 65-70
Water Temp - 82 degrees
Any ideas as to why it is continuing to rise?
